Initial fee consistent with prior deals; royalty at 6% of gross, marketing levy 2%. Franchisee, Pellmont Hospitality, shows adequate liquidity and prior multi-unit experience. Buildout financing carried entirely by franchisee. Our exposure limited to brand and supply-chain commitments via the Dorsett distribution hub. Break clauses at years four and seven. Recommend approval with standard audit rights. The confidential note on our expansion plans sits below.

board note of kageg-bahof: The renewal with Holwynax Holdings closes at $2 million a year, 5 percent below the last contract. Project Ulaath slips by two quarters because of the supplier delay.

Subject: Partner SFTP drop — new owner

Hi,

As you review the pending changes to the Harborline ingest scripts, note that ownership of the partner SFTP drop is changing at the end of the month. This includes key rotation, the nightly pull job, and the quarantine folder for malformed files. Review comments on the retry logic should still go through the normal PR flow, but questions about drop-folder conventions or partner onboarding now go to the new owner. The incoming owner is listed below.

signatory, tagaf-bahaf: Praael Fenmir Rusok

The Orvane Labs bike cage and the east and west parking gates operate on separate access schedules, and facilities desk staff should note that visitor vehicles may only use the west gate between 07:00 and 19:00. Cyclists requesting cage access must show a valid day pass, and their details should be entered in the access ledger before the cage is opened. Gates must never be propped open, even briefly, during deliveries. When a manual override is required at either gate, use the code below.

staff pass of fadup-fawig = bdg-FUNKS-4

## Authentication

The Gaugeling sidecar scrapes process metrics and forwards them to the central aggregator every 15 seconds. It authenticates on startup and refuses to flush without a valid credential, so metrics silently queue in memory if auth fails. For local development, configure the sidecar with the staging key below.

gateway credential: zpat23_7qqcGYpjzOqgK8YXbFMnj5A